- Location: Old depot at junction of U.S. 27 and Ga. 85W in Warm Springs
Text of marker: "OLD DEPOT SITE WARM SPRINGS. Here stood the little depot of the Southern R. R. where Franklin D. Roosevelt arrived &; departed on his many visits to Warm Springs during the years 1924-1945. A personal interest in the after treatment of infantile paralysis led him, in 1924, to the thermal springs at Pine Mtn., the helpful aid of which inspired him to establish the Georgia Warm Springs Foundation to combat infantile paralysis on a national level. During his presidency of the United States, his Georgia home was the Little White House where he departed this life, April 12, 1945. 099-4 GEORGIA HISTORICAL COMMISSION 1957" - External Identifiers:
